For decades, South African communities have relied on local newspapers to stay informed, connected, and engaged with the stories that matter most. Now, these beloved publications are entering a new and exciting chapter under Novus Media, a dedicated holding company that has acquired 21 community newspapers previously hosted under News24.

Starting at the end of March, these newspapers will officially transition from News24 to their new home under Novus Media—a move that strengthens their commitment to independent, community-driven journalism.

Why the Move from News24?

The transition marks a strategic shift toward empowering community newspapers with full ownership of their platforms, advertising opportunities, and editorial direction. Under News24, these newspapers operated within a larger, national news ecosystem, but with Novus Media, they gain greater autonomy and the ability to grow their local readership without external limitations.
